Bourbon, Peach and Ginger Jam

  • Level: Easy
  • Yield: 2 quarts
  • Total: 45 min
  • Active: 45 min

Ingredients

32 ounces peeled and chopped peaches, frozen or fresh 

1/2 cup sugar 

4 tablespoons minced ginger 

1/3 cup bourbon 

1 tablespoon lemon juice 

1/2 tablespoon lemon zest 

1/2 tablespoon salt 

Directions

  1. In a saucepan over medium heat, combine the peaches, sugar and ginger. Cook for 10 minutes, stirring every couple minutes. Pour in the bourbon, lemon juice and zest. Simmer until thickened, about 20 minutes. Stir every couple minutes to prevent scorching. Stir in the salt. Store refrigerated for up to 1 month.

I followed the recipe to the letter using fresh peaches, it yielded 4 cups (2 pints) nowhere near 2 quarts. Mine came out more saucy then a jam. The taste was quite nice, a balance of, sweet, tart, spicy with a bit of saltiness. I used table salt, but will use kosher next time, I would like it a tad less salty. This would be great for savory applications, as a sauce for pork, chicken or salmon.
